The railway runs daily services from Whitby to Pickering and from Pickering to Whitby. To visit Goathland by train, you can begin at Pickering and buy a day-rover ticket on the NYMR, which allows you to stop at any station you choose.

The services run Northbound from Pickering to Whitby via Levisham, Newton Dale Halt (request stop), Goathland and Grosmont stations and Southbound from Whitby or Grosmont to Pickering via Grosmont, Goathland, Newtondale Halt (request stop) and Levisham.

Does Pickering have a train station?
Pickering railway station is the southern terminus of the North Yorkshire Moors Railway and serves the town of Pickering in North Yorkshire, England.

Was Harry Potter filmed in Pickering?
Producers scoured Britain’s heritage railways to find a location for Hogsmeade, the station serving Hogwarts. They settled on Goathland, on the North York Moors Railway between Whitby and Pickering. The platforms are used to the presence of film crews – it was a long-running setting for ITV period soap Heartbeat.

What are the internal services between Pickering and Grosmont?
Our Internal Services, running between Pickering and Grosmont, offers passengers more flexibility or the option of a shorter journey. These services stop at Pickering, Levisham, Goathland and Grosmont only and are available as singles or returns.
